CPrintDialog::CPrintDialog

使う CPrintDialog ( BOOL bPrintSetupOnly, DWORD dwFlags = PD_ALLPAGES | PD_USEDEVMODECOPIES | PD_NOPAGENUMS | PD_HIDEPRINTTOFILE | PD_NOSELECTION、 CWnd ※ pParentWnd = NULL );

パラメーター

bPrintSetupOnly

標準の Windows の [印刷] ダイアログ ボックスまたは [印刷設定] ダイアログ ボックスが表示されるかどうかを指定します。このパラメーターは、標準の Windows 印刷設定ダイアログ ボックスを表示するにはTRUEに設定します。Windows の [印刷] ダイアログ ボックスを表示するにはFALSEに設定します。BPrintSetupOnlyFALSEの場合は、プリンターの設定オプション ボタンが表示されるは [印刷] ダイアログ ボックスでまだです。

dwFlags

1 つまたは複数のフラグをビットごとの OR 演算子を使用して結合] ダイアログ ボックスの設定をカスタマイズできます。たとえば、 PD_ALLPAGESフラグ、ドキュメントのすべてのページに既定の印刷範囲を設定します。参照してください、 これらのフラグの詳細については Win32 SDK ドキュメントでPRINTDLG構造。

pParentWnd

ダイアログ ボックスの親ウィンドウまたはオーナー ウィンドウへのポインター。

解説

Windows の印刷またはプリンターの設定ダイアログ オブジェクトを構築します。このメンバー関数は、オブジェクトを構築します。DoModalメンバー関数を使用してダイアログ ボックスを表示するには。

メモbPrintSetupOnlyFALSEに設定すると、コンス トラクターを呼び出すときは、 PD_RETURNDCフラグが自動的に使用されます。DoModalGetDefaults、またはGetPrinterDCを呼び出す後、プリンター DC に戻ります m_pd.hDC 。この DC を使う CPrintDialogの呼び出し元によって解放する必要があります。

使う CPrintDialog 概要|nbsp;クラス メンバー |階層図(&N)

参照特価;CPrintDialog::DoModal :: PrintDlg(&N)

Index